  2. Product Types:

    • Silicone-based defoamers: These are widely used due to their effectiveness across various applications and compatibility with different formulations.
    • Non-silicone defoamers: These include mineral oil-based, vegetable oil-based, and water-based defoamers, often preferred for specific applications where silicone-based defoamers are not suitable.
    • Powder defoamers: These are used in applications where liquid defoamers are not feasible or convenient.

  3. Application Areas:

    • Paints coatings: Defoamers are added to paint formulations to prevent foam during manufacturing, filling, and application processes, ensuring smooth surfaces and consistent quality.
    • Pulp paper: They help control foam in the pulp washing, papermaking, and paper coating processes, improving paper quality and production efficiency.
    • Water treatment: Defoamers are used to control foam in wastewater treatment plants, preventing overflow and ensuring effective treatment processes.
    • Food processing: They are added to food and beverage processing operations to prevent foam formation during mixing, cooking, and packaging, maintaining product quality and safety.
    • Pharmaceuticals: Defoamers are used in pharmaceutical manufacturing processes to eliminate foam generated during mixing, blending, and tablet compression.

  6. Regulatory Environment:

    • Regulatory bodies such as the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) in the United States and the European Chemicals Agency (ECHA) in the European Union impose regulations on the use of defoamers to ensure their safety and environmental compliance.
    • Compliance with regulations regarding chemical safety, toxicity, and environmental impact is crucial for defoamer manufacturers to maintain market access and consumer trust.
